gpt4 book ai didi

jquery - rowsTotal、recordsFiltered 解释 Jquery DataTable

转载 作者:行者123 更新时间:2023-12-03 22:09:41 24 4
gpt4 key购买 nike

我正在阅读数据表文档,但找不到答案。我的问题是:

我有一个包含 10.000 行的表。我按州进行搜索,结果是 3000 行。从 3000 行开始,我将每页显示 20 行。

“recordsTotal”:这里应该有什么值?,“recordsFiltered”:这里应该有什么值?,

如果recordsTotal值必须是10.000,如果不感兴趣我可以隐藏这个值吗?

最佳答案

来自official documentation :

recordsTotal

Total records, before filtering (i.e. the total number of records in the database)

recordsFiltered

Total records, after filtering (i.e. the total number of records after filtering has been applied - not just the number of records being returned for this page of data).

您的回复应该是:

{
"draw": 1,
"recordsTotal": 10000,
"recordsFiltered": 3000,
"data": [
// ... skipped 20 records ...
]
}

我相信 recordsTotal 仅用于信息面板显示 3000 个条目中的 1 到 20 个(从 10000 个总条目中过滤)。如果您不使用信息面板,则不必返回 recordsTotal 属性。

属性recordsFiltered也被jQuery DataTables用来计算显示数据集所需的页数。

参见Server-side - Returned data了解更多信息。

关于jquery - rowsTotal、recordsFiltered 解释 Jquery DataTable,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/43161353/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com